It’s no news that former Super Eagles boss Gernot Rohr has been booted out of the Nigerian job after much deliberations concerning his future.

The decision would mean he (Rohr) would not lead Nigeria to the AFCON showpiece in Cameroon where he would have made use of talents like Samuel Chukwueze, Wilfred Ndidi, Joe Aribo and the mesmerizing Chidera Ejuke.

Now the NFF has chosen to go the way of Austin Eguavoen in terms of an interim appointment for the Eagles coaching position.

But shouldn’t the Nigerian football federation have looked else? The appointment was widely criticized in the media as many Super Eagles fans thought it was a step backwards.

They feel that sacking Gernot Rohr is a good one though some are still believing in the German-French tactician’s ability to perform on the Eagles job but bringing Eguavoen was a bad option from all stances.

You can argue that on and off as regards the appointment of former Super Eagles right back Eguavoen. But let’s wait and see his performance before we call him a failure.

Though his tenure as the coach of the Super Eagles in the past was not the best we’ve had, there are reasons for optimism even as he was replaced with Berti Vogts then in the Eagles coaching hot seat.

The fans would have wanted maybe Emmanuel Amuneke or any other foreign coach.

But for now, let’s learn to be patient-supporting our own as that would be needful in charting a new course for the National team, (Super Eagles) under Austin Eguavoen.
